It wasn’t the nasty grudge match with a massive knockout finish some fight fans may have been expecting, but Ian Machado Garry won his fight over Geoff Neal with a display of technical striking. The welterweight bout was part of the UFC 298 main card at Honda Center in Anaheim, Calif., and saw Garry (14-0 MMA, 7-0 UFC) defeat Neal (15-6 MMA, 7-4 UFC) by split decision (30-27, 28-29, 30-27). Garry took a measured, disciplined approach. Most of his success came from technical striking, as he circled away from Neal, who struggled to find his rhythm
